    73, BISHOPS AVENUE, BROMLEY, BR1 3ET

    This semi-detached freehold property on Bishops Avenue last sold in June 2021 for £775,000. Based on price growth in the BR1 district since then, its estimated current value is £823,738 — placing it in the 93rd percentile nationally and the 84th percentile within BR1. The property covers 131 m² (1,410 sq ft), giving an estimated value of £6,288 per m². The EPC rating is D, with a potential rating of B.

    District Context — BR1

    BR1 covers Bromley town centre and surrounding areas in Greater London's south-east. It is an affluent, established residential district with strong professional employment and family-oriented communities.
